Interpretation
Fiorina’s line underscores that “politics” is not confined to government: it also describes the power dynamics, coalition-building, negotiation, and competition for resources that shape corporate decision-making. In a boardroom, outcomes often depend not only on data and strategy but on relationships, incentives, reputations, and differing stakeholder agendas. The quote implicitly challenges the idealized view of business as purely meritocratic or technocratic, suggesting that leaders must understand influence and governance as much as markets and operations. It also hints at accountability: corporate power can have public consequences, so the political nature of boardroom choices deserves scrutiny rather than denial.
